Installing, Upgrading, and Migrating to Windows 7
Overview/Description
Windows 7 is a new desktop operating system from Microsoft. The majority of computer users interact with desktop operating systems more than any other type of computer operating system today. This course will show you how to install Windows 7 in a single and multiboot environment, along with showing the process involved in migrating or upgrading from previous Microsoft operating systems. This course maps to exam 70-680: TS: Windows 7 Configuring. This exam is required for the certification MCTS: Windows 7, Configuration.
Target Audience
Individuals taking the first of the Windows 7 exams â 70-680: TS: Windows 7 Configuring, which is required for the certification MCTS: Windows 7, Configuration.
Prerequisites
At least one year of experience in the IT field, as well as experience implementing and administering any Windows client operating system in a networked environment
Expected Duration (hours)
1.5
Lesson Objectivesrecognize how to install Windows 7 to dual boot with Windows Vista
identify the hardware requirements of Windows 7
recognize how to prepare various installation sources for Windows 7
prepare a USB disk as an installation source for Windows 7
install Windows 7 to dual boot with Windows Vista
recognize how to use the Easy Transfer tool to migrate from Windows Vista to Windows 7
recognize how to use an in-place upgrade to upgrade from Windows Vista to Windows 7
use USMT to create an encrypted store
recognize the best practices for migration with USMT
use USMT to decrypt a store and migrate files and settings
upgrade and migrate from Windows XP and Windows Vista to Windows 7
